What is Backtesting?

Backtesting is a systematic method of evaluating the effectiveness of a trading strategy by applying it to historical market data. This technique helps traders assess how their strategy would have performed in the past, providing valuable insights into its potential for future success. Effective backtesting enables traders to refine and fine-tune their strategies based on historical data, thereby increasing their chances of making informed decisions in the live market.

Why is Backtesting Important?

  1. Risk Management: Backtesting helps traders understand the risk associated with a strategy. By analyzing past performance, traders can identify periods of drawdowns and assess whether they can withstand potential losses.
  2. Strategy Validation: It is crucial to validate a trading strategy before risking real capital. Backtesting allows traders to confirm whether the strategy is sound, based on historical data.
  3. Strategy Improvement: By identifying weaknesses and strengths in a trading strategy, traders can make necessary adjustments and improvements to enhance its performance.
  4. Emotion-Free Evaluation: Backtesting provides a data-driven assessment of a strategy, eliminating emotional biases that often cloud judgment during live trading.
  5. Confidence Building: Successful backtesting instills confidence in a trading strategy, helping traders execute trades with conviction.

Steps to Conduct Backtesting

  1. Data Collection: Obtain historical price data for the currency pairs you want to trade. Reliable sources include trading platforms, data providers, and financial websites.
  2. Strategy Formulation: Define your trading strategy with clear entry and exit rules. This should include criteria for technical indicators, risk management, and trade size.
  3. Backtesting Software: Use trading software or platforms that offer backtesting capabilities. MetaTrader 4 and MetaTrader 5 are popular choices. Import your historical data into the software.
  4. Testing Period: Select a specific time frame for backtesting. A common choice is to use at least several years of historical data to capture different market conditions.
  5. Trade Simulation: Execute simulated trades using your strategy based on historical data. Record each trade’s entry and exit points, as well as the profit or loss.
  6. Analysis: After simulating a significant number of trades, analyze the results. Look for patterns, drawdowns, win rates, and other performance metrics.
  7. Optimization: Based on your analysis, fine-tune the strategy by adjusting parameters or even revising the entire approach.
  8. Forward Testing: Implement the optimized strategy in a demo account or with small, real capital to see how it performs in current market conditions.
  9. Continuous Improvement: Backtesting should be an ongoing process. Regularly review and update your strategy as market dynamics change.

What is Optimization?

Optimization is the process of refining a trading strategy to improve its performance and profitability. It involves adjusting variables, such as parameters for technical indicators, stop-loss and take-profit levels, and position sizing, to find the best combination for achieving consistent gains.

Why is Optimization Important?

  1. Maximizing Profit Potential: Optimization aims to identify the most profitable settings for a trading strategy, allowing traders to make the most out of their investments.
  2. Risk Mitigation: By optimizing a strategy, traders can find ways to reduce drawdowns and control risk, leading to more consistent and stable returns.
  3. Adaptation to Market Changes: Optimization enables traders to adapt to changing market conditions and fine-tune their strategies accordingly.
  4. Customization: Every trader has different risk tolerance and trading goals. Optimization allows for customization to align with these preferences.

Steps to Optimize a Trading Strategy

  1. Select Parameters to Optimize: Identify the specific parameters or variables within your strategy that you want to optimize. This could be indicators, entry and exit rules, or risk management settings.
  2. Optimization Software: Use backtesting software that provides optimization tools. MetaTrader platforms, for example, have built-in optimization features.
  3. Parameter Range: Define a range of values for each parameter to test. For example, if optimizing a moving average crossover strategy, you might test different combinations of moving average periods.
  4. Performance Metrics: Specify the performance metrics you want to maximize, such as profit, risk-adjusted return, or win rate.
  5. Optimization Run: Run the optimization process, which involves testing the strategy with different parameter combinations. The software will provide results for each combination tested.
  6. Result Analysis: Analyze the optimization results to identify the parameter values that yield the best performance metrics. Consider factors such as profit, drawdown, and consistency.
  7. Walk-Forward Testing: Perform walk-forward testing to ensure that the optimized strategy continues to perform well in live market conditions.
  8. Implementation: Implement the optimized strategy in a demo account or with real capital. Continuously monitor and fine-tune the strategy as needed.

Challenges and Considerations

  1. Over-Optimization: Be cautious of over-optimizing a strategy to fit historical data perfectly. Over-optimized strategies may not perform as well in real-time trading due to curve-fitting.
  2. Sample Size: The quality of your backtesting results depends on the amount and quality of historical data used. Larger sample sizes are generally more reliable.
  3. Market Conditions: Historical data may not accurately represent current market conditions. Therefore, forward testing is crucial to verify strategy performance in real-time.
  4. Risk Management: While optimization focuses on profit potential, it’s essential to maintain sound risk management principles to protect capital and minimize losses.
  5. Psychological Factors: Even with an optimized strategy, emotions can still impact trading decisions. Traders should work on discipline and mental resilience.
